Understanding Daycare Abuse: Recognizing Red Flags and Legal Rights in Mississippi
Understanding Daycare Abuse is a crucial step in ensuring the safety and well-being of children. In Mississippi, recognizing red flags can help parents and guardians protect their children from potential harm. Common signs of daycare abuse include unexplained injuries, changes in behavior, or consistent inconsistencies in the child’s stories. Supporting Survivors: Resources and Steps After Daycare Abuse Discovery
When a parent discovers that their child has been subjected to daycare abuse in Mississippi, it’s crucial to prioritize the survivor’s well-being. The first steps involve documenting all evidence, including any photos or videos, and taking notes on specific instances of abuse. Contacting local authorities and a trusted daycare abuse lawyer in Mississippi is essential for legal protection and to ensure the abuser faces consequences.
Surviving childcare abuse can be traumatic, so providing emotional support is vital. There are numerous resources available, including therapy services designed for child victims, support groups, and hotlines offering confidential counseling. These measures help children process their experiences, rebuild trust, and regain a sense of safety.
